Fans of the long-running series Bust-A-Move will soon have something to look forward to, as Natsume, Inc., who purchased the license from Taito, a subsidiary of Square Enix, has announced the release of Bust-A-Move 4 for the PlayStation 3, PS Vita and PSP via the Playstation Network.
“Bust-a-Move 4 was a very successful and popular title, and fans have been asking for a re-release for years,” said Hiro Maekawa, CEO of Natsume Inc in a statement. “We were very happy to bring this classic back to new systems as a digital download!”
Bust-A-Move 4 contains eight playable modes, including an Edit mode where players can design their own levels. It also boasts a cast of 14 playable characters.
